Podstawy programowania w C++ według standardów C++17 i C++20, podstawowe struktury danych oraz metody pracy z nimi. Z perspektywy rozwoju oprogramowania omówiono programowanie funkcji: zwykłych i rekurencyjnych, funkcji constexpr, wyrażeń lambda i funkcji lambda, przeciążanie oraz szablony funkcji. Omówiono bardziej...
złożone zagadnienia C++: wskaźniki i pamięć dynamiczna, struktury i klasy, konstruktory i destruktory, metody i przeciążanie operacji, praca z plikami tekstowymi, reprezentacja liczb oraz operacje bitowe.
Omówiono ważne dla początkujących tematy: zintegrowane środowisko Code::Blocks, lokalizacja wejścia i wyjścia, błędy podczas pisania kodu, niezdefiniowane zachowanie, testowanie oraz pisanie kodu testowego. Książka zawiera 150 przykładów programów i ponad 90 zadań do samodzielnej pracy. Materiał został przetestowany w praktyce podczas nauczania studentów i uczniów oraz przygotowywania ich do egzaminów.
Autor: Валерий Лаптев
Wydawnictwo: BHV
Seria: Dla początkujących
Ograniczenia wiekowe: 14+
Rok wydania: 2025
ISBN: 9785977519618
Liczba stron: 368
Rozmiar: 232х165х12 mm
Typ osłony: Soft
Waga: 482 g
ID: 1722570